Wilson Kipsang is the strongest marathoner of 2013/2014

His victory in New York last Nov. 2 only sealed an outstanding two-year period for Wilson Kipsang. A victory then achieved on a particularly cold and windy day and in a tight finish against Desisa that highlighted his exceptional athletic skills and superlative running elegance.

Kipsang was awarded the men’s World Marathon Majors title (World Marathon Majors, or the “world championship” of marathons, based on his results in the six cities-it is in fact also known as the “Big Six”-of Tokyo, Boston, London, Berlin, Chicago and New York).

In fact, in the past two years he has won three, becoming the first man to win them in this time frame: in fact, he has triumphed in London, Berlin (where he set in 2013 the world record of 2h 3′ 23″ remained undefeated for a year) to finish a stellar hat trick in New York.
